/**
|
|
* Safe way to retrieve the list of online players from the server. Depending on the
|
|
* implementation of the server, either an array of {@link Player} instances is being returned,
|
|
* or a Collection. Always use this wrapper to retrieve online players instead of {@link
|
|
* Bukkit#getOnlinePlayers()} directly.
|
|
*
|
|
* @return collection of online players
|
|
*
|
|
* @see <a href="https://www.spigotmc.org/threads/solved-cant-use-new-getonlineplayers.33061/">SpigotMC
|
|
* forum</a>
|
|
* @see <a href="http://stackoverflow.com/questions/32130851/player-changed-from-array-to-collection">StackOverflow</a>
|
|
*/
|
|
@SuppressWarnings("unchecked")
|
|
public Collection<? extends Player> getOnlinePlayers() {
|
|
if (getOnlinePlayersIsCollection) {
|
|
return Bukkit.getOnlinePlayers();
|
|
}
|
|
try {
|
|
// The lookup of a method via Reflections is rather expensive, so we keep a reference to it
|
|
if (getOnlinePlayers == null) {
|
|
getOnlinePlayers = Bukkit.class.getDeclaredMethod("getOnlinePlayers");
|
|
}
|
|
Object obj = getOnlinePlayers.invoke(null);
|
|
if (obj instanceof Collection<?>) {
|
|
return (Collection<? extends Player>) obj;
|
|
} else if (obj instanceof Player[]) {
|
|
return Arrays.asList((Player[]) obj);
|
|
} else {
|
|
String type = (obj == null) ? "null" : obj.getClass().getName();
|
|
ConsoleLogger.warning("Unknown list of online players of type " + type);
|
|
}
|
|
} catch (NoSuchMethodException | IllegalAccessException | InvocationTargetException e) {
|
|
ConsoleLogger.logException("Could not retrieve list of online players:", e);
|
|
}
|
|
return Collections.emptyList();
|
|
}

/**
|
|
* Method run upon initialization to verify whether or not the Bukkit implementation
|
|
* returns the online players as a Collection.
|
|
*
|
|
* @see #getOnlinePlayers()
|
|
*/
|
|
private static boolean initializeOnlinePlayersIsCollectionField() {
|
|
try {
|
|
Method method = Bukkit.class.getDeclaredMethod("getOnlinePlayers");
|
|
return method.getReturnType() == Collection.class;
|
|
} catch (NoSuchMethodException e) {
|
|
ConsoleLogger.warning("Error verifying if getOnlinePlayers is a collection! Method doesn't exist");
|
|
}
|
|
return false;
|
|
}
